Rick’s is a family run business based out of Hampstead, NH. We specialize in manufacturing and distributing high quality replacement parts for charging & starting components in the Powersports Industry. What began as a small motorcycle salvage business in the late 1970s has grown to a well recognized, highly reputed brand name in the Motorsport world. And now we’re adding to our team!
